Description

Apex Legends is a free-to-play battle royale built around squads of “Legends” with unique abilities, praised for its fast, fluid movement, gunplay, and ping communication system.

Step into the shoes of Peter Parker as The Amazing Spider‑Man, battling iconic villains across a sprawling, fully realized New York City. The game blends fast‑paced hack‑and‑slash combat with exploration, letting players swing, crawl, and fight their way through a story tied to the 2012 film. Developed by Beenox and published by Activision, this single‑player title offers a mix of action, adventure, and open‑world freedom, delivering a cinematic experience for fans of the web‑slinger.
